    Mirabeau is a station on line 10.
    The station opened on September 30, 1913.
    It has a single side platform which is only served by trains heading to Gare d'Austerlitz. Despite the absence of a stop in the opposite direction, it is crossed by the ramp towards Église d'Auteuil from the track towards Boulogne - Pont de Saint-Cloud, which separates immediately afterwards from that towards Austerlitz by a tunnel dug at immediate proximity to the vault. The very particular profile of the station, which faces the steep slope of the track towards Boulogne, is due to the great depth of the line following its crossing of the Seine and to the fact that, to reach the station adjoining the Church of Auteuil, the route had to go around the foundations of the church from the southwest.

      You can only get to this station if you take line 10 in the eastbound direction!
      Line 10 has separate eastbound and westbound sections between the stations Boulogne-Jean Jaurès and Javel-André Citroën.
      There are 3 stations on the eastbound section, including Mirabeau, and 3 different stations on the westbound section. Look at the map at 0:48 in the video or at this map from Wikipedia: upload.wikimedia.org/wikipedia/commons/9/91/Paris_Metro_Ligne_10.svg
      So if you enter the metro at Mirabeau and you want to go back, you have to exit at the next station Javel-André Citroën, then take the metro in the other direction, ride 4 stations until Boulogne-Jean Jaurès, and change directions again there to get to Mirabeau again...
      The ramp leads to the next station in westbound direction: Eglise d'Auteuil.
